Brief description
Annual hourly air quality and meteorological data by monitoring site for the 2014 calendar year. For more information on air quality, including live air data, please visit [environment.des.qld.gov.au/air](https://environment.des.qld.gov.au/air).**Data resolution:** One-hour average values (one-hour sum for rainfall)
**Data row timestamp:** Start of averaging period
**Missing data/not monitored:** Blank cell
**Calm conditions:** No hourly average wind direction is reported when the hourly average wind speed is zero
**Barometric pressure:** Values are at monitoring station elevation, not corrected to mean sea level
**Daily zero/span response check:** Automated instrument zero/span response checks are conducted daily between midnight and 1am at Queensland Government sites (can differ at industry sites). Where this takes place an ambient hourly value cannot be reported.
**Sampling height:** Four metres above ground (unless otherwise indicated)
**PLEASE NOTE:**
* The Townsville Coast Guard 2014 air quality monitoring site data was updated on 26/10/2015 due to the wind direction sensor being misaligned and the reported wind direction values have now been corrected.
* The Auckland Point 2014 air quality monitoring site data was updated on 24/04/2018 to remove invalid wind data due to a sensor fault.

Brisbane CBD (South East Queensland) 2014 hourly air quality and meteorological data - **Period of operation:** 1 January to 31 December 2014 \r\n**Site location:** Latitude: -27.4774; Longitude: 153.0281 \r\n**AS/NZS 3580.1.1 site classification:** Neighbourhood \r\n**AS/NZS 3580.1.1 compliance (pollutants):** Complies, except for: \r\n\r\n* Equipment located in room on sixth floor of building. \r\n* Nephelometer inlet located on eastern side of building, 1 metre out from building. \r\n* PM10 inlet located on building roof above equipment room, 1 metre above roof surface. \r\n* Building lift shaft higher than PM10 inlet located 8 metres south of inlet. \r\n\r\n**AS/NZS 3580.14 compliance (meteorology):** Complies, with exceptions: \r\n\r\n* Building lift shaft higher than wind sensor and within 10 metres of sensor. \r\n* Buildings higher than wind sensor located within 40 metres of sensor. \r\n* Temperature sensor located in non-aspirated radiation shield 1 metre above the roof surface. \r\n\r\n**Wind:** Ultrasonic sensor \r\n\r\n* Height above roof level: 4 metres. \r\n* The wind direction sensor is aligned to magnetic north. The reported wind direction is referenced to true north by application of a magnetic declination correction of +11 degrees to the sensor output value. \r\n\r\n**Temperature:** Capacitive ceramic sensor \r\n**PM10:** Tapered Element Oscillating Balance (TEOM) Model 1400AB operated in accordance with AS 3580.9.8 \r\n\r\n* Measurement values do not compensate for loss of semi-volatile components from the collected particulate matter. \r\n* Instrument output values are adjusted in accordance with US EPA equivalence designation method EQPM-1090-079 requirements (scaled by 1.03, offset by +3.0). \r\n* After adjustment, negative hourly PM10 concentrations less than -0.5 µg/m^3 are removed and concentrations between -0.5 µg/m^3 and 0.0 µg/m^3 are set to 0.0 µg/m^3. \r\n\r\n**Visibility-reducing particles:** Nephelometer operated in accordance with AS/NZS 3580.12.1 \r\n\r\n* Detector spectral response centred at 530 nm. \r\n* Instrument output offset and/or scaled based on calibration and daily zero/span response data.

Townsville Coast Guard (Townsville) 2014 hourly air quality and meteorological data - **Part industry-operated monitoring site (1 January to 30 April):** Data received from industry validated by Queensland Government. From 1 May the industry and Queensland Government sites were amalgamated and all data validation was conducted by the Queensland Government. \r\n**Period of operation:** 1 January to 31 December 2014 \r\n**Site location (1 January to 30 April):** Latitude: -19.2526; Longitude: 146.8272 (wind, rainfall, PM10 - industry site), Latitude: -19.2542; Longitude: 146.8257 (temperature, TSP - Queensland Government site) \r\n**Site location (1 May to 31 December):** Latitude: -19.2526; Longitude: 146.8272 (joint industry/Queensland Government site) \r\n**AS/NZS 3580.1.1 site classification:** Peak (port operations) \r\n**AS/NZS 3580.1.1 compliance (pollutants):** Complies fully \r\n**AS/NZS 3580.14 compliance (meteorology):** Complies, except for: \r\n\r\n* Trees within 5 metres to the west of the industry/joint monitoring station (no obstructions in direction of port operations). \r\n* Monitoring stations located on asphalt surface. \r\n\r\n**Wind sensor:** Ultrasonic sensor \r\n\r\n* Height above ground level: 10 metres. \r\n\r\n**Temperature:** Capacitive ceramic sensor \r\n**Rainfall (1 January to 30 April):** Tipping bucket rain gauge. \r\n**PM10:** Tapered Element Oscillating Balance (TEOM) Model 1400AB operated in accordance with AS 3580.9.8 \r\n\r\n* Measurement values do not compensate for loss of semi-volatile components from the collected particulate matter. \r\n* Instrument output values are adjusted in accordance with US EPA equivalence designation method EQPM-1090-079 requirements (scaled by 1.03, offset by +3.0). \r\n* After adjustment, negative hourly PM10 concentrations less than -0.5 µg/m^3 are removed and concentrations between -0.5 µg/m^3 and 0.0 µg/m^3 are set to 0.0 µg/m^3. \r\n\r\n**TSP (1 January to 7 May):** Tapered Element Oscillating Microbalance (TEOM) Model 1400AB operated in accordance with AS 3580.9.8 \r\n\r\n* Measurement values do not compensate for loss of semi-volatile components from the collected particulate matter. \r\n* Instrument output values are adjusted in accordance with US EPA equivalence designation method EQPM-1090-079 requirements for PM10 (scaled by 1.03, offset by +3.0). \r\n* After adjustment, negative hourly TSP concentrations less than -0.5 µg/m^3 are removed and concentrations between -0.5 µg/m^3 and 0.0 µg/m^3 are set to 0.0 µg/m^3. \r\n\r\n**TSP (8 May to 31 December):** Tapered Element Oscillating Microbalance (TEOM) Model 1405 operated in accordance with AS/NZS 3580.9.13 (excepting FDMS requirements) \r\n\r\n* Measurement values do not compensate for loss of semi-volatile components from the collected particulate matter. \r\n* Reported concentrations are uncorrected instrument output values. \r\n* Negative hourly TSP concentrations less than -0.5 µg/m^3 are removed and concentrations between -0.5 µg/m^3 and 0.0 µg/m^3 are set to 0.0 µg/m^3. \r\n\r\n**PLEASE NOTE:** The Townsville Coast Guard 2014 air quality monitoring site data was updated on 26/10/2015 due to the wind direction sensor being misaligned and the reported wind direction values have now been corrected.
